- KG–12 is the first fit check. Verify that the grade span matches the years your student needs, especially around transition grades.
- Regular school type affects comparison. Compare it with other other schools before treating it like a one-for-one substitute.
- Suburb: Small matters for daily life. Use the locale and address as a starting point, then confirm commute, boundary, and transportation details locally.
- Charter status can mean separate application, lottery, or enrollment rules. Confirm eligibility before assuming neighborhood assignment.

2,378 students
Summit Charter Academy reports 2,378 students, larger than most same-level county peers. Among 11 other other schools in Tulare County with enrollment data, 11 report fewer students and 0 report more. The peer median is 384 students.
13 other schools
The same-level county median enrollment is 387 students. Use it to separate unusually small or large schools from typical peers.
